Transaction 048a23fa328686d454458ecc8c4dc35384b079f824995e1bdf031abd90a580b7

4 Input
2 Outputs
  • 048a23fa328686d454458ecc8c4dc35384b079f824995e1bdf031abd90a580b7:0
  • value  156116
    address  31hztRuHvd5BCnkcoJo3GvzPFS6ssrbonu
  • 048a23fa328686d454458ecc8c4dc35384b079f824995e1bdf031abd90a580b7:1
  • value  15447846
    address  3G2XzQxbr8SvAecySdEoC3cV8Yx75d6WyB